site stats

How to implement hystrix

Web9 feb. 2024 · Hystrix implements the Circuit Breaker pattern. You don’t have to write the network or thread programming to handle fault tolerance in the Microservices. You need to use Hystrix library just... Web12 okt. 2024 · @EnableHystrix enables the Hystrix functionalities into the Spring Boot application. To run the method as Hystrix command synchronously you need to …

Quick Guide to Spring Cloud Circuit Breaker Baeldung

Web25 sep. 2024 · 2 Answers Sorted by: 1 You will have to implement a fall back for each method. However using the FallbackFactory might make this easier and allow each method to call one reusable method. Maybe you don't really want hystrix fallbacks if they are the same for each method. All try catch might solve the same problem. Share Improve this … Web21 feb. 2024 · If x percentage of calls are failing, then the circuit breaker will open. slidingWindowSize () – This setting helps in deciding the number of calls to take into account when closing a circuit breaker. slowCallRateThreshold () – This configures the slow call rate threshold in percentage. If x percentage of calls are slow, then the circuit ... largest urban sculpture garden in the us https://paulwhyle.com

SpringCloud断路器——Hystrix_贼爱学习的小黄的博客-CSDN博客

Web47K views 1 year ago Microservices Tutorial. In this video of Hystrix circuit breaker pattern and Fault Tolerance in Microservices Spring boot of Microservices in Java tutorial series … WebStart the four microservices we have developed- Go to url - localhost:8080/employee/message Go to url - localhost:8080/consumer/message Go to url - localhost:8080/employee/message1. The fallback method will be called as follows - Spring Cloud Gateway Hystrix Implementation using Property Based Configuration The Maven … henna hair how long

How To Implement Hystrix Circuit Breaker In …

Category:Circuit Breaker: Hystrix vs Resilience4J Microservices #6

Tags:How to implement hystrix

How to implement hystrix

15 What is Hystrix - Spring Boot Microservices Level 2

Web14 apr. 2015 · If you want to configure Hystrix in code, you can use the Archaius ConfigurationManager class like this: ConfigurationManager.getConfigInstance ().setProperty ( "hystrix.command.HystrixCommandKey.execution.isolation.thread.timeoutInMilliseconds", … WebHystrix -The Software Circuit Breaker Implementation Hystrix is part of the Netflix open-source software set of libraries. Spring Cloud provides easy-to-use a wrapper to take advantage of Hystrix libraries. Just like a physical …

How to implement hystrix

Did you know?

Web27 mrt. 2024 · hystrix服务降级处理方案. 【摘要】 当一个服务端的业务响应的时间过长的时候或者业务处理逻辑处理异常,不应该等待,应该给出一种处理方法超时导致服务器变慢 (转圈) --->超时不再等待出错 (宕机或程序运行出错) --->出错要有兜底pom文件依赖 : Web3 jul. 2024 · The first step is to construct a HystrixCommand or HystrixObservableCommand object to represent the request you are making to the dependency. Pass the constructor any arguments that will be needed when the request is made. Construct a HystrixCommand object if the dependency is expected to return a single response. For example:

Web29 mrt. 2024 · 暂时没有考虑发生异常之后进行回调返回特定内容. •. 业务系统通过 feign 调用基础服务,基础服务是会根据请求抛出各种请求异常的(采用标准http状态码),现在我的想法是如果调用基础服务时发生请求异常,业务系统返回的能够返回基础服务抛出的状态码 ... Web23 jul. 2024 · Firstly, Hystrix allows us to define fallback methods. Secondly, Whenever a method starts throwing errors due to any reason and it has a fallback method defined, Hystrix will invoke the fallback method rather than invoking the main method. That is it will isolate the erroneous method for time being.

Web11 apr. 2024 · Spring Cloud Hystrix是一个用于处理分布式系统的延迟和容错的库。它通过隔离服务之间的访问点,防止级联故障,并提供了一个备用方案,以便在出现故障时继续运行。Hystrix通过实现断路器模式来实现这些功能,这意味着它可以在服务之间建立一个断路器,以便在服务出现故障时自动切换到备用方案。 WebHystrix是Netflix开源的一个延迟和容错库,用于隔离访问远程服务、第三方库,防止出现级联失败,是一种保护机制。 2.雪崩问题 微服务中,服务之间调用关系错综复杂,一个请求,可能需要调用多个微服务接口才能实现,会形成非常复杂的调用链路。

Web22 mrt. 2024 · In order to implement Circuit Breaker mechanism, we use Spring cloud Hystrix. We add the @EnableHystrix annotation on our main application class to make our Spring Boot application act as a Circuit Breaker. In addition, @HystrixCommand (fallbackMethod = “DUMMY METHOD NAME”) at RestController method level.

WebChoose either Gradle or Maven and the language you want to use. This guide assumes that you chose Java. Click Dependencies and select Spring Reactive Web (for the service … henna hair dye youtubeWeb11 apr. 2024 · Spring Cloud Hystrix是一个用于处理分布式系统的延迟和容错的库。它通过隔离服务之间的访问点,防止级联故障,并提供了一个备用方案,以便在出现故障时继续 … henna hair salons in orange county caWeb条件装配 是 Spring Boot 一大特点,根据是否满足指定的条件来决定是否装配 Bean ,做到了动态灵活性,starter的自动配置类中就是使用@Conditional及其衍生扩展注解@ConditionalOnXXX做到了自动装配的,所以接着之前总结的 Spring Boot自动配置原理和自定义封装一个starter ... henna hair dye while pregnant